Siddhartha Degree College has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
Courses Eligibility B.Com Candid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ognised school/board. BBA Candid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ognised school/board. M.Sc. Candidates must have completed B.Sc. Degree with Chemistry subject as an optional with above mentioned marks from any recognised University/Institute .
Candidate must have studied Chemistry at least four papers of 100 marks each.
OR
Candidates who have completed B.Sc. Degree with Chemistry subject as an optional and must have studied a minimum of 30 credits in Chemistry.
A pass in the Qualifying Examination is sufficient for SC/ST candidates.
The candidates passing the examination compartmentally and securing required percentage of marks or equivalent CGPA are also eligible.
